Matt Kalil is making headlines as he responds to controversial comments made by his ex-wife, Haley, regarding the size of his genitals, which she claims played a role in their divorce. This has led him to file a lawsuit against her, seeking damages for what he describes as invasive commentary that has negatively affected his life post-retirement.

According to the lawsuit, obtained by TMZ Sports, Kalil asserts that Haley’s remarks during a November 2025 appearance on the streaming show “Mar-Athon,” hosted by influencer Marlon Garcia, have caused significant distress. In the clip, Haley suggested that Kalil’s genital size was a substantial factor in their separation and candidly stated that engaging in sexual relations with him left her “in tears.” She further described the situation using a metaphor involving “two coke cans, maybe even a third.”

The former Carolina Panther alleges that these statements have subjected him and his family to unwanted public scrutiny and invasive commentaries. The ramifications have extended to his current wife, who has received unsettling messages stemming from the viral fallout of Haley’s comments. Kalil is concerned not only for his own reputation but also for the impact of Haley’s words on his loved ones.

In his lawsuit, Kalil seeks redress for invasion of privacy, citing the disclosure of private and intimate details about his personal life and sexual identity. He also claims that Haley has capitalized on her comments by benefiting financially through increased social media engagement and viewership, which he argues is unjust enrichment stemming from her allegedly defamatory statements about him.
